Specifications
-
Seed Type: Flower Seeds
-
Variety: Pink Nora Barlow
-
Plant Type: Perennial in many climates; may reseed naturally
-
Plant Height: 18–30 inches
-
Bloom Period: Late spring to early summer
-
Soil Requirements: Well-drained, fertile soil
-
Sun Exposure: Full sun to partial shade
-
Watering: Moderate, consistent moisture
-
Planting Depth: Surface sow or cover lightly
-
Spacing: 12–18 inches
-
Germination Time: 14–30 days

USDA Zones & Planting Months
-
Zones 3–5:
-
Start indoors: February–April
-
Sow outdoors: April–June
-
-
Zones 6–7:
-
Start indoors: January–March
-
Sow outdoors: March–May
-
-
Zones 8–10:
-
Sow outdoors: October–December
-
Start indoors: December–February
